Financial Reality Driving Barcelona’s Decisions
Barcelona’s ongoing financial recovery has forced the club to rethink how contracts are structured. High fixed wages are gradually being replaced with incentive-based agreements.
The veteran’s renewal reflects this broader policy shift. Instead of guaranteeing a substantial salary, Barcelona are prioritizing flexibility—rewarding performance while protecting the club’s wage structure.
This approach also aligns with La Liga’s Financial Fair Play regulations, which continue to limit Barcelona’s spending power.
